What Are LED Canopy Lights?

LED canopy lights are specially designed lighting fixtures used to illuminate outdoor areas, particularly under structures such as canopies, covered walkways, and ceilings. These lights are commonly installed in locations like gas stations, parking garages, loading docks, and entranceways, where high-quality, durable lighting is crucial for safety and security. LED technology, known for its energy efficiency and long lifespan, makes these lights a top choice for both commercial and residential outdoor lighting needs.

Why Choose LED Canopy Lights?

  1. Energy Efficiency
    One of the most significant advantages of LED canopy lights is their energy efficiency. Compared to traditional incandescent or fluorescent lighting, LEDs consume far less power while providing the same or even better brightness. This leads to lower electricity bills, making LED canopy lights an excellent long-term investment. In fact, LEDs use up to 80% less energy than conventional lighting systems, which translates to considerable savings over time.

  2. Longer Lifespan
    LED lights are renowned for their durability and long lifespan. While traditional bulbs may need to be replaced every few months or years, LED canopy lights can last for up to 50,000 hours or more, depending on usage. This reduces the need for frequent maintenance and bulb replacements, saving both time and money in the long run.

  3. Durability and Weather Resistance
    Outdoor lighting fixtures are exposed to the elements, which means they must be able to withstand harsh weather conditions. LED canopy lights are designed to be highly durable, often featuring weather-resistant housing to protect the internal components from moisture, dust, and extreme temperatures. This makes them ideal for use in a variety of outdoor environments, including areas with heavy rain, snow, or high winds.

  4. Improved Brightness and Clarity
    LED canopy lights provide bright, clear, and even illumination, enhancing the safety and visibility of outdoor spaces. The crisp, focused light emitted by LEDs is ideal for areas that require high levels of visibility, such as parking lots, gas stations, and walkways. The consistent light distribution eliminates dark spots and shadows, ensuring that every corner of the area is well-lit and secure.

  5. Environmentally Friendly
    LED technology is eco-friendly, both in terms of energy consumption and waste production. LEDs do not contain harmful chemicals like mercury, which is commonly found in traditional lighting sources such as fluorescent lamps. Additionally, because LEDs are energy-efficient and long-lasting, they contribute to reducing carbon footprints by minimizing the need for frequent bulb replacements and energy consumption.

Factors to Consider When Choosing LED Canopy Lights

When selecting LED canopy lights for your outdoor space, there are several factors to consider to ensure that you make the best choice for your needs:

  1. Brightness (Lumens)
    The brightness of an LED canopy light is typically measured in lumens. The higher the lumens, the brighter the light. Depending on the size of the area you wish to illuminate, you will need to choose a light with the appropriate lumen output to ensure that the space is adequately lit.

  2. Color Temperature
    LED canopy lights come in various color temperatures, ranging from warm white to cool white. The color temperature you choose will depend on the atmosphere you want to create. For example, cooler color temperatures (5000K and above) provide bright, daylight-like illumination, which is ideal for security purposes. Warmer color temperatures (2700K to 3500K) create a more relaxed and inviting atmosphere.

  3. IP Rating
    The IP (Ingress Protection) rating of an LED canopy light indicates its resistance to dust and water. When choosing an LED canopy light for outdoor use, its essential to select one with a high IP rating (usually IP65 or higher) to ensure that the light is weatherproof and can withstand exposure to rain and moisture.

  4. Mounting Type
    LED canopy lights come with various mounting options, including pendant, surface, and recessed mounting. Consider the structure of your outdoor space and choose the mounting type that best suits your installation needs.
